What is an R7 Hose?
The R7 hose is a type of thermoplastic rubber hose designed for high-temperature and high-pressure applications. It is often reinforced with synthetic fibers to enhance its durability and strength. The “R” denotes that it meets the requirements set by the Society of Automotive Engineers (SAE), while the “7” indicates specific performance standards concerning temperature and pressure. Non-conductive R7 hoses, in particular, are crucial for environments where electrical conductivity poses risks, making them a safe choice for various applications.
Key Features
1. Non-Conductive Material One of the most significant advantages of non-conductive R7 hoses is their construction from materials that do not conduct electricity. This feature is invaluable in industrial settings where electrical hazards may be present, such as in manufacturing plants or during automotive servicing.
2. High-Temperature Resistance Non-conductive R7 hoses can typically withstand temperatures ranging from -40°F to 212°F (-40°C to 100°C) without losing their integrity. This characteristic makes them suitable for a wide range of applications, from hydraulic systems to air and water transfer.
3. Lightweight and Flexible Despite their strength, non-conductive R7 hoses are relatively lightweight and flexible, allowing for easy handling and installation. Their flexibility also aids in their adaptability to various working environments and makes them easier to maneuver in tight spaces.
4. Chemical Resistance These hoses exhibit excellent resistance to a variety of chemicals, oils, and fuels, which makes them particularly useful in automotive and industrial applications where exposure to such substances is common.
Benefits of Using Non-Conductive R7 Hoses
- Safety The foremost benefit of non-conductive R7 hoses is safety. Their non-conductive properties ensure that operators are protected from electrical shock, reducing workplace hazards in environments with electrical equipment.
- Versatility These hoses can be used in various settings, including agriculture, construction, automotive, and manufacturing. Their ability to handle different chemicals and withstand extreme temperatures makes them a versatile choice for professionals.
- Cost-Efficiency While the initial investment in high-quality non-conductive R7 hoses can be higher, their durability and lifespan often lead to lower long-term costs. Reduced wear and tear mean fewer replacements and less downtime in your operations.
